PER CURIAM.
Antonio Metcalf appeals after the district court1 revoked his supervised release.
His counsel has moved to withdraw and has filed a brief arguing that the district court
erred in concluding he violated the conditions of his supervised release.
Having reviewed the record, we conclude the district court did not clearly err
by finding that the government proved the violations by a preponderance of the
evidence. See United States v. Staten, 990 F.3d 631, 635 (8th Cir. 2021) (per curiam)
(standard of review). Accordingly, we affirm the judgment, and we grant counsel’s
motion to withdraw.
